The Avior system is home to at least one habitable world and as of 3145, is located in the Regulan Fiefs.[2][3]
Contents
System Description[edit]
The Avior system is located near the New Praha and Tiber systems.[4]
System History[edit]
The Avior system was colonized during the First Exodus from Terra and was incorporated into the Principality of Regulus prior to the formation of the Free Worlds League.[5]

Planetary History[edit]
In 3081, the Avior system was under a military interdiction; as an attempt to curb the activities of the Principality of Regulus units constantly raiding into the Duchy of Oriente, Oriente forces had seized the jump points in the system to allow them to search all inbound and outbound traffic. At the same time, elements of the Fifth Oriente Hussars were suppressing Regulan supply bases on the surface of the planet.[29]
